Title: Grown Kids Music Group Streamlines Sync Workflows with Fully Cleared, One-Stop Catalog Built for Modern Music Supervisors

United States, 7th Jul 2026 — Grown Kids Music Group (GKMG), a premier boutique sync licensing label, has launched an expanded, high-impact catalog engineered specifically to eliminate friction for music supervisors across film, television, advertising, and gaming. Designed with flawless pre-cleared metadata and 100% one-stop master and publishing rights, the label addresses the entertainment industry's critical need for speed, high-end production value, and zero-clearance liability.As search engines shift toward direct, high-intent discovery via AI search agents, music supervisors require agile partners capable of delivering pristine, broadcast-ready music instantly. Grown Kids Music Group meets this demand by providing immediate access to a highly curated roster of independent artists whose production value rivals major label releases. To further scale this global reach, GKMG has integrated a strategic UK partnership with TMG (The Moment Global), a leading music licensing and supervision firm led by prominent music supervisor Ola-Grace Elias. This international alliance weaves elite music supervision, international sync A&R, and music editing capabilities directly into the vertical GKMG ecosystem.Grown Kids Music Group expands its global footprint through a strategic acquisition with The Moment Global, offering unified music services, global brand reach, talent management, co-production ventures, and strategic industry partnerships."Production timelines are moving faster than ever, and a music supervisor’s greatest asset is time," said a representative from Grown Kids Music Group.
